Orientdb - 匹配 - “命令尚未执行”

时间:2016-07-22 18:12:30

标签: orientdb

我有一个带有2个顶点的Orientdb数据库

拥有100万条记录的Pesquisador

Publicacao也有100万条记录

和Edge COLABORA_COM与6,239,382

我需要选择数千名出版物数量最多的研究人员。

我执行命令

SELECT  psq1.psq_nome AS nomePesquisador, COUNT(pub1) AS qtdPub
FROM (
  MATCH 
    {class:Pesquisador, as:psq1}.outE("PUBLICOU").inV(){as:pub1}
  RETURN psq1, pub1
)
GROUP BY psq1
ORDER BY qtdPub DESC, nomePesquisador
LIMIT 1000;

然后thera是错误“命令尚未执行”

如果我将MATCH RETURN限制为250000条记录(RETURN psq1,pub1 LIMIT 250000),则匹配执行时无错误

是否有内存错误?

0 个答案:

没有答案